Understanding the NECO Certificate
Before diving into the collection process, it’s crucial to understand what the NECO certificate represents. This certificate is proof that a student has successfully completed the Senior Secondary Certificate Examination (SSCE). It is recognized by universities, colleges, and employers across Nigeria and is essential for further education and job applications.

Steps to Collect Your Original NECO Certificate
Step 1: Verify Your Eligibility
Before you can collect your NECO certificate, ensure that you are eligible. You must have:
- Successfully completed the NECO SSCE in your respective year.
- Paid all necessary fees associated with the examination.
Step 2: Gather Required Documents
To collect your NECO certificate, you need to present specific documents. Make sure to have the following:
- NECO Examination Number: This is typically found on your examination registration slip.
- Identification Document: A government-issued ID (like a National ID, driver’s license, or passport).
- Payment Receipt: Proof of payment for the examination fees.
- Confirmation of Results: A printout of your NECO results can also be helpful.
Step 3: Locate the NECO Office
The next step is to find the nearest NECO office. NECO has various zonal offices across Nigeria. You can visit the official NECO website or contact their customer service for the specific location of the office relevant to your state or region.
Step 4: Visit the NECO Office
Once you have located the nearest NECO office, plan your visit. Here are some tips:
- Best Time to Visit: Try to visit on weekdays, preferably in the morning to avoid long queues.
- Dress Appropriately: While this might seem trivial, being neatly dressed can sometimes expedite your process.
Step 5: Submit Your Documents
At the NECO office, approach the designated counter for certificate collection. Submit your gathered documents to the officials. They will verify your information and ensure you are indeed eligible to collect your certificate.
Step 6: Pay the Collection Fee (if required)
In some cases, there might be a fee associated with collecting your NECO certificate. If this applies to you, ensure you have the required amount in cash, as not all offices accept electronic payments.
Step 7: Wait for Processing
After submitting your documents, you may need to wait for a short period while the officials process your request. This wait can vary from office to office, but it’s usually not too long.
Step 8: Collect Your Certificate
Once your request is processed, you will be given your original NECO certificate. Ensure you check the details on the certificate for any discrepancies before leaving the office.

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them
1. Lost Examination Number
If you’ve lost your NECO examination number, you can retrieve it by contacting the NECO help desk or checking your registration slip.
2. Missed Collection Dates
Sometimes, students miss the collection dates. If this happens, contact NECO directly to find out the next available dates or alternative options for collection.
3. Incomplete Documentation
Inadequate documentation can lead to delays. To avoid this, always double-check the list of required documents before your visit.
